What get_rating does on Iconnect

AI agents call get_rating to retrieve information from Iconnect without modifying anything. It is typically the context-gathering step in research, monitoring, and reporting workflows, before the agent takes action elsewhere.

Why get_rating is rated Low

This is a pure read operation that queries existing track metadata. It returns status information (rating, favorited flag, disliked flag) without modifying anything. The absence of any write/execute/delete language and the explicit 'Get' verb confirm this is a Read operation. The severity is low because exposing track preference metadata poses minimal security risk.

From the tool's definition Tool retrieves metadata about a track: 'Get the rating, favorited, and disliked status for a track.' No arguments suggest modification of track data, only retrieval of existing attributes.

Questions about get_rating

What does the get_rating tool do? +

Get the rating, favorited, and disliked status for a track. It is categorised as a Read tool in the Iconnect MCP Server, which means it retrieves data without modifying state.

How do I enforce a policy on get_rating? +

Register the Iconnect MCP server in PolicyLayer and add a rule for get_rating: allow, deny, rate-limit, or require approval. Point your MCP client at the PolicyLayer proxy URL and the rule is enforced on every call, before it reaches Iconnect. Nothing to install.

What risk level is get_rating? +

get_rating is a Read tool with low risk. Read-only tools are generally safe to allow by default.

Can I rate-limit get_rating? +

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the get_rating r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.

How do I block get_rating completely? +

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for get_rating.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.

What MCP server provides get_rating? +

get_rating is provided by the Iconnect MCP server (iconnect-mcp). PolicyLayer sits as a proxy in front of this server to enforce policies before tool calls reach the server.
